This bill mandates the President to designate Ansarallah as a foreign terrorist organization (FTO) within 30 days of the Act's enactment, pursuant to the Immigration and Nationality Act. This designation is a critical step towards imposing sanctions on the group for its involvement in international terrorism. Following this designation, the President must also submit a determination to Congress within 30 days regarding whether specific individuals, including Abdul Malik al-Houthi Abd al-Khaliq Badr al-Din al-Houthi Abdullah Yahya al-Hakim , are officials, agents, or affiliates of Ansarallah. The bill clarifies that "Ansarallah" refers to the movement also known as the Houthi movement or any other alias, ensuring comprehensive application of the sanctions.
To require the imposition of sanctions with respect to Ansarallah and its officials, agents, or affiliates for acts of international terrorism.
